2'-F-RNA Integrin ??3 subunit Protein 6.5 nM (reported value) Binding Buffer: PBS supplemented with 0.05% Tween-20 and 0.1% BSA.
Incubation Time: 1 h.
Folding Protocol: Heated to 95°C for 5 min and then snap-colled on ice of 5 min.
Assay Type: ELONA

No binding was observed to integrin aV??6 at 250 nM, whereas the aptamer recognized integrin aV??3 and aIIb??3 at 100 pM. See also aptamer aV-1 which binds to the aV subunit.
